Club Wyndham National Harbor
Set in the waterfront National Harbor district, this modern all-suite…
For Rent
Westgate Resort Myrtle Beach Oceanfront Resort,South Carolina,United States
For Rent
Set in the waterfront National Harbor district, this modern all-suite…
Overlooking the Las Vegas Strip, this sprawling high-rise casino resort…